Electric Vehicles

Electric VehicleThe City of Houston and Reliant Energy are working to ensure a better future for our city by exploring new technologies that will conserve energy and improve our environment. We're partnering to demonstrate the power of electric vehicles and to show how this environmentally friendly solution can work in our busy urban lifestyles.

Reliant Energy has sponsored the conversion of 10 City of Houston cars to plug-in hybrid electric vehicles (PHEVs) that can deliver up to 100 mpg as well as lower emissions. It's a unique opportunity for all of us to learn more about how PHEV technology works for real people in real-world situations.
